You can tell if one liquid is more dense than another by comparing their densities. The denser liquid will have a greater mass per unit volume than the less dense liquid. One common way to compare densities is by observing which liquid sinks and which floats when they are layered on top of each other in a container.
This is found out by knowing the densities of the liquids in question. The liquid with the smaller density will always be on top, while the liquid with the higher density will be at the bottom.
Comparing the density of an object with that of a liquid will determine whether the object will float or sink in the liquid. If the object is less dense than the liquid, it will float; if it is more dense, it will sink.

Yes.EDIT: Density is not the sole factor. While denser liquids proportionally outweigh less dense liquids thus earning themselves a lower position when in contact with with liquids of less density, chemical properties also come into play. Lets say we have a container of water, (1.0 g/L), and we add pure lemon juice, (approx 1.1 g/L). Instead of forming distinct layers, the lemon juice is diluted by the water. The molecules combine to form into a chemically inseparable solution due to solubility.Vegetable oil .91-.93 g/cm3 - Water 1.0 g/. Mix the two and the vegetable oil will float on top of the water, therefore, the LESS dense liquid will float on top, while the MORE dense liquid will sink to the bottom. You can determine if a substance is more or less dense than water by comparing their densities. Water has a density of 1 g/cm3 at 4 degrees Celsius. If a substance has a density greater than 1 g/cm3, it is more dense than water. If it has a density less than 1 g/cm3, it is less dense than water.
